Iris Memory Care of NW OKC is looking for caregivers - certified nursing assistants and certified medication aides. Our greatest need is for Certified Medication Aides on the 3pm - 11pm shift. We also have need for either a CNA or CMA on the 11pm - 7am shift. We always have spots for PRN as well! If you love memory care and have a heart for seniors, we'd love to meet you!
We are a small, freestanding memory care assisted living community conveniently located off of John Kilpatrick Turnpike at 122nd and MacArthur in NW OKC. We have a small campus with a total of 54 residents split between three buildings. As a community focused on memory care, all of our residents are coping with Alzheimer's or other form of dementia. We are an age-in-place community, so you will care for residents all throughout the spectrum of the disease.
Rate of pay for CNAs starts at $16 per hour. Higher pay rates will be given to those with a MAT or who are CMA/ACMA. Rate of pay is negotiable based upon experience. Priority will be given to candidates who have worked in memory care before. We schedule full-time schedules as Sunday - Thursday or Tuesday - Saturday.
Specific Responsibilities:
Responsible for providing Resident services and other duties as assigned. Duties include personal services, activities of daily living, housekeeping, laundry, social-recreational activities, life enrichment, meal services, and other tasks as needed for Resident care and service delivery.
Primary Essential Job Duties:
- Adheres to and conveys philosophy of supporting dignity, privacy, independence, choice, individuality, and a home-like environment for Residents.
- Assists with activities of daily living/ADL’s, environmental orientation, dining services, life enrichment programs, laundry and housekeeping, meal services, and other care services assigned, while encouraging self-care and independence.
- Maintains clean, neat, comfortable, safe environment for Residents, staff, and visitors.
- Offers comfort and support, emotionally and physically, to Residents.
- Assists with vital signs and weight monitoring monthly or more frequently as required for all Residents and completes all required documentation.
- Puts Resident Service First: Ensures that Residents and families receive the highest quality of service in a caring and compassionate atmosphere, which recognizes the individuals’ needs and rights
- Assists with individual Resident and group social recreational activities.
Qualifications
Job Qualifications:
- Must be an active on the OK Nurse Aide Registry as a certified nursing assistant
- Minimum one year experience in working with older adults as a personal care assistant preferred.
- Twelve (12) plus years of education preferred. High school diploma or GED required.
- At least 18 years old, or older if required per the state regulations.
- Experience with dementia residents preferred.
- Meet continuing education requirements and certifications on job classification and position, including state requirements.
- Ability/willingness to perform all position responsibilities adequately.
